December 17, 2007
The Whitby Scout Trail received a grant of $1000.00 from the Baagwating Community Association, as a donation to help expand the Whitby Scout Trail.
I attended a ceremony and luncheon last Friday on Scugog Island at the Baagwating Community Association building and received the cheque, along with a number of other community representatives who in total received over $100,000.00.
Our whole process was made possible by Dave Archer, who wrote a letter of application. Thanks Dave for your foresight, dedication and consideration.
Victor Woodburne and I are currently in discussion with the Whitby Area, Scouts Canada Treasurer, in order to find a way to keep the funds in Whitby and earmarked for the Scout Trail and related enterprises. Wish us luck.
